The industrial landscape in Japan is currently shifting towards the Hydrogen Economy. Titanium sheets are critical components in PEM electrolyzers and fuel cells due to their exceptional corrosion resistance in acidic environments. Furthermore, Japan's aging population has driven a 15% annual increase in the demand for titanium medical grade plates. Our Grade 23 (Ti-6Al-4V ELI) materials are specifically processed to have low interstitial elements, ensuring higher ductility and fracture toughness for surgical implants used in clinics from Sapporo to Okinawa.

Send Inquiry NowWhen selecting a Titanium Plate Manufacturer for the Japanese market, understanding the correlation between international and local standards is essential. We provide a cross-reference for our materials to ensure they meet your internal quality systems:
| ASTM Grade | JIS Equivalent | Typical Application in Japan | Corrosion Resistance |
|---|---|---|---|
| Grade 1 | JIS Class 1 | Heat Exchangers (Kyushu Power) | Excellent |
| Grade 2 | JIS Class 2 | Chemical Piping (Osaka Plants) | Very Good |
| Grade 5 | JIS Class 60 | Aerospace (Nagoya Hub) | High Strength |
